Born in Freepoert - New York, 1941, Kay Gardner also known as the "Cosmos Wonder-Child" was a musician, composer, author and music producer involved in using music for healing and creative purposes. Her most notable compositions feature, chamber, symphony, choir, flute, voice and piano. Before her death in 2002, she released 17 albums and was very prominent and passionate about promoting female musicians.
